Windows Server 2019 and .NET 4.8?

Copper Contributor

Hello,

 

On a fully updated Windows Server 2019, roles and features allow me to install only .NET 4.7.

 

One of the solution we are using require .NET 4.8 (Adaxes).

 

When I install .NET 4.8 using the installer available here https://support.microsoft.com/en-us/topic/microsoft-net-framework-4-8-offline-installer-for-windows-...

 

It works, I can install Adaxes, but it break ServerManager as well as Azure AD Connect.

 

What's the correct procedure to install .NET 4.8 on Server 2019 without breaking anything else?
